1) Temporary vs. long rental, what should I choose?
Use a short rental for single sign-ups or testing. Choose a longer rental if you’ll be relogging in, switching devices, or expecting periodic checks. Keeping the same line reduces re-verification prompts and lockouts.
2) How fast do OTPs arrive in New Zealand?
Typically within seconds. During peak hours, let the countdown finish, then resend once, and switch routes if necessary. Load balancing across carriers often means that a nearby route can resolve delays.

5) What if the OTP never arrives?
Confirm the full international format (with country code) and the correct route. Wait for the timer, resend once, then switch routes. Most issues are formatting errors or peak-time congestion.
